Civil War Medal of Honor Recipient. He served in the Civil War as a Private in Company B, 11th New Jersey Volunteer Infantry. He was awarded the CMOH for his bravery at the Battle of Chancellorsville, Virginia, on May 3, 1863. His citation reads "Remained in the rifle pits after the others had retreated, firing constantly, and contesting the ground step by step". His Medal was issued on May 6, 1892.
